Output 307e6574814325e7adc609eba46b6d8d30957ce3815b0a7782f6fefd7f8d133a:1

value
388987869
script pubkey
OP_0 OP_PUSHBYTES_20 d73ee40912d62d53cdaf3af5af3b271fda3b8517
address
bc1q6ulwgzgj6ck48nd08t667we8rldrhpgh7m540d
transaction
307e6574814325e7adc609eba46b6d8d30957ce3815b0a7782f6fefd7f8d133a
spent
true